Salman Khan comes clean on the alleged support to Raj Thackeray's MNS

A couple of days ago, Salman Khan made it clear in a press conference that he had in no way, supported the MNS agenda of hostility towards Uttar Bhartiya's (people from UP, Bihar). There were alot of stories swirling in the press that he along with a few other prominent film personalities had supported Raj Thackeray. But this was very diffeent from the actual story. The truth is that they had only supported his freedon of speech and were opposed to the court gagging him in his statements to the press and media.

Sallu said, "Raj is a very dear friend and I know him for very long. But I have not supported his cause. My father (Khan senior) just said that Raj has the freedom of speech, nothing more."
This innocuous statement was twisted by the media to mean that a few film artistes actaully supported the MNS agenda. Among them were Maharashtrian actors like Nana Patekar, Shreyas Talpade, and Sajid Khan and a few others.

Salman who has had a mixed year with a hit in Partner and a super flop in Saawariya is looking forward to a couple of important projects like God Tussi Great Ho, Yuvraaj and remake of Telugu super hit Pokiri.

Salman argued that his own family were originally migrants - father from Madhya Pradesh, maternal Grand father from Kashmir, and paternal Grand father from Kashmir. Thats the reason he said it was impossible for him to support such demands.
